About Cockermouth

Wordsworth was born here in 1770, and you can still feel that poetic sensibility threading through Cockermouth's Georgian streets. This proper Cumberland market town sits where the River Cocker meets the Derwent, creating a landscape that inspired one of Britain's greatest poets. The town centre retains its character with independent shops and traditional pubs, though it's pleasantly quiet midweek.

Venture beyond the town boundaries and you're into serious walking country. Clints Crags offers a decent scramble for those after Wainwright's lesser-known peaks, while Watch Hill on Setmurthy Common provides cracking views without the Lakeland crowds. The surrounding countryside is riddled with ancient woodlands - Peel Wood and Bewsgill Wood make for lovely afternoon rambles, and you'll often have them to yourself.

History buffs should seek out St Kentigern Cross, an intriguing archaeological remnant, while the church of St Kentigern itself anchors the town's spiritual heritage. For families, Arkleby Leisure Swimming Pool keeps the children happy on rainy days, which admittedly come with some frequency in this part of Cumberland.

Cockermouth sits roughly 30 miles southwest of Carlisle, easily reached via the A595. It's a smart base for exploring both the northern Lakes and the Solway Coast without the premium prices of Keswick or Ambleside.
